Find the area of a regular hexagon with a 48 inch perimeter

    If the hexagon's perimeter is 48 inches, then 48/6 means that every side measures 8 inches.

    The formula for the area of a hexagon is A = (3 √3) / 2 * a^2

    a was found to be 8 inches, so when you plug it in, the area of the hexagon is 166.28 square inches.
